E. When to Go on a Family Boat Tour

The summer months, from June to August, are the best times to take a boat excursion in Amsterdam. The weather is nice at this time of year, and the Amsterdam canals are buzzing with activity.

However, it is also the busiest travel period, so anticipate crowds. Avoiding peak tourist season and choosing a tour during the spring or fall, when the weather is still beautiful and the crowds are lower, may be the best option if you’re travelling with young children.

F. What to Expect on an Amsterdam Boat Tour

The Sights

The Herengracht, Prinsengracht, and Keizersgracht are just a few of the notable canals you will explore during a boat tour in Amsterdam, which normally lasts between one and two hours. You’ll visit some of Amsterdam’s most well-known sites on the tour, including the Skinny Bridge, the Westerkerk, and the Anne Frank House.

G. What to Bring

Bring the following essentials before setting off on your boat trip through the city centre:

  • Even on a cool day, the sun may be very strong on the water, so wear sunscreen and caps.
  • Snacks are typically not included in boat tours, so it is recommended to pack your own. Some boat tours offer snacks and meals on board, such as the pizza cruise or the Amsterdam Dinner Cruise.
  • Warm clothes — even on a warm day, on the water it can feel chilly, so make sure to pack a jacket or sweater.
  • Bring a camera with you so you may record all the incredible views and memories.
